LARGEST PORTRAIT CREATED USING COCNUT SHELLS

By 09/05/2025 Mass Attempt

This is to certify that Kala Shastram, based in Harda, Madhya Pradesh, has successfully set a world record for creating the largest portrait made using coconut shells. The magnificent artwork depicts Adiyogi Shiva and spans an area of 16,546 square feet.

The portrait was completed at the Isha Foundation, located at Velliangiri Foothills, Ishana Vihar, Coimbatore, with the dedicated efforts of 22 artists.

The record-setting attempt commenced on January 20, 2025, and was completed on January 25, 2025. It has been officially recognized by the World Records Community.
